What is a Figma developer?

A Figma Developer is a professional who specializes in using Figma, a collaborative interface design tool, to create, prototype, and refine user interfaces for web and mobile applications. They often bridge the gap between design and development by turning Figma designs into interactive prototypes or production-ready code. Figma Developers work closely with designers and front-end engineers to ensure design consistency and usability across digital products. Their expertise includes working with Figma's features, plugins, and sometimes integrating Figma assets with development workflows.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Figma developer?

To thrive as a Figma Developer, you need a strong grasp of UI/UX design principles, proficiency in Figma, and a solid understanding of front-end development langu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. Familiarity with design systems, prototyping tools, and version control platforms such as Git is typically required. Collaboration, attention to detail,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for translating design concepts into functional, user-friendly interfaces. These skills ensure high-quality, consistent digital products and smooth collaboration between design and development teams.

How does a Figma developer typically collaborate with designers and other team members during a project?

A Figma Developer works closely with designers by translating design prototypes into interactive, production-ready components while ensuring the final product matches the intended user experience. They often participate in design handoff meetings, provide technical feedback, and use Figma's collaborative features to communicate changes and resolve questions in real time. Additionally, they may work alongside front-end developers, product managers, and QA specialists to ensure seamless integration of designs into the development workflow. This role requires strong communication skills and a proactive approach to addressing design and technical challenges.

What is the difference between Figma Developer vs UI Designer?

AspectFigma DeveloperUI Designer
Primary FocusImplementing designs in Figma, creating prototypes, collaborating on design systemsDesigning user interfaces, creating visual layouts, selecting color schemes and typography
Skills & CertificationsProficiency in Figma, basic understanding of front-end code, collaboration skillsDesign tools (Adobe XD, Sketch), visual design skills, user experience knowledge
Work EnvironmentDesign teams, product teams, often in tech or digital agenciesCreative studios, in-house design teams, digital agencies

While both roles work closely on digital product design, a Figma Developer specializes in translating designs into interactive prototypes and collaborating on design systems within Figma, often with some coding knowledge. A UI Designer focuses on creating the visual aspects of interfaces, emphasizing aesthetics and user experience.
